Rome, Oct. 25 (LaPresse) – A lot of fear for Sofia Goggia, who in the first run of the season, in the Soelden giant slalom, hit a gate with her arm and fell, compromising her debut race. Fortunately, nothing serious for the diamond of the Italian team ahead of Milan-Cortina. The 32-year-old from Bergamo got up immediately and went down to the valley on her own. All this under the worried eyes of Federica Brignone, who for a few moments must have relived the injury at the National Championships that is still keeping her off the slopes.
